Just went in to change the mag release, now the slide locks up when a mag is inserted, the trigger seems to sometimes work, sometimes not, and now the mags don't drop free they need to be pulled out by hand. So I just want to get this thing back to reliable operation.
 
Does the mag fall out on its own when you press the mag release when the slide is closed or still needs to be pulled out by hand?

Lock the slide back, look down into the magwell, press down the mag release, does part of mag release protrude into the magwell from the side closest to your finger ie. opposing side of the locking tab? If no, slowly insert a mag while depressing the mag release paying attention to the side of the of the mag release that has the locking tab. Does it rub against the side of the magazine? If so, the mag release could be holding up the mag from dropping free and you may need to remove some material from the mag release.

If the above is not the case, the second cause can be that your magazine base pads (if you're using extended base pads) aren't thick enough, allowing the mag to get pushed deeper into the magwell causing the very top of the magwell to catch the breach face of the slide. One way to test this, insert a mag into the magwell on an open slide. Push up on the magazine base pad and see if it pushes up on the breach face of the slide. You may need to push up on the magazine while pulling back the slide a hair bit more. I have this problem using Xtreme base pads on my Limited Custom.

With the trigger, sounds like you need to give some more "slack" in the trigger adjustment screw.
